Maha Sinnathamby is of Tamil descent, born in Malaysia. He lived in a rubber estate Rantau before moving to Australia and becoming an entrepreneur with a vision to build an entire city.

Mr Sinnathamby founded Greater Springfield almost 20 years ago on nearly 3000 hectares outside of Brisbane. Springfield is now a community of more than 21,000 residents living, working and raising families. Predictions are that the population will swell by more than 100,000 people within the next 20 years into a city the size of Darwin.
